- Angioplasty and Stenting: Opens narrowed or blocked arteries using balloons and stents to restore healthy blood flow.
- Embolization Procedures: Blocks abnormal blood vessels to control bleeding, treat fibroids, aneurysms, and certain tumors.
- Tumor Ablation: Radiofrequency, microwave, or cryoablation destroys selected tumors without major surgery.
- Transarterial Chemoembolization (TACE): Delivers chemotherapy directly into liver tumors while reducing their blood supply.
- Varicose Vein Treatment: Minimally invasive procedures close damaged veins and improve blood circulation.
- Image-Guided Biopsy: Accurate tissue sampling using CT or ultrasound guidance for diagnosis.
- Drainage Procedures: Image-guided drainage of infected fluid collections or abscesses with minimal discomfort.
- Vascular Access Procedures: Placement of dialysis catheters, ports, and central venous access devices using imaging guidance.

Interventional Radiology uses advanced imaging guidance to diagnose and treat a wide range of conditions, including blocked arteries, varicose veins, tumors, internal bleeding, uterine fibroids, kidney disorders, and vascular diseases through minimally invasive procedures.
Most Interventional Radiology procedures are performed through a small needle puncture or tiny incision using imaging guidance. This often results in less pain, reduced blood loss, faster recovery, shorter hospital stays, and minimal scarring.
Most procedures are performed using local anesthesia, conscious sedation, or general anesthesia depending on the treatment. Patients usually experience minimal discomfort during and after the procedure.
Recovery depends on the type of procedure performed. Many patients can return to normal daily activities within a few days, while more complex procedures may require a longer recovery period.
Yes. Many patients who have high surgical risk due to age or other medical conditions may benefit from minimally invasive Interventional Radiology procedures as an alternative treatment option.
Interventional Radiologists use technologies such as ultrasound, CT scan, fluoroscopy, angiography, and MRI to guide instruments accurately during diagnosis and treatment.
No. Many Interventional Radiology procedures are performed as day-care treatments, allowing patients to return home on the same day. Some complex procedures may require short hospital observation.
